Package: libsdl1.2debian Version: 1.2.12-1 Severity: normal
Hello, seeing that both xmoto and tuxpaint fail to restore screen resolution on exit and both depend on libsdl1.2debian, I guess there's something wrong with it. Running "xrandr -s 1280x1024" restores it, but kids can't do that by themselves ... This is not a new bug, has been there for months now.
